Why Goat Hair Removal is a Critical Bottleneck in Meat Processing
1. Hygiene Non-Compliance Risks
Manual depilation fails to meet USDA/EU food safety standards, risking product recalls and export bans. A single hair contaminant can trigger a Class I recall costing $10M+ in losses (Source: USDA FSIS).
In 2024, 12% of goat meat shipments to the EU were rejected due to hair contamination (EFSA Report).
2. Labor Intensity & Rising Costs
Manual depilation requires 8-10 workers per 100 goats/hour, with labor costs accounting for 30-40% of processing expenses. In the U.S., meat processing plants face a 25% labor shortage (Source: NAMP).
3. Inconsistent Quality & Yield Loss
Traditional methods (scraping, singeing) damage 15-20% of carcass surface, reducing usable meat yield. Uneven hair removal leads to customer complaints and brand reputation damage.
4. Throughput Limitations
Manual processes cap production at 50-80 goats/hour, inability to scale with demand. The global meat processing equipment market is projected to grow at 5.0% CAGR through 2034—automation is no longer optional.
5. Cross-Contamination Risks
Shared tools in manual depilation spread E. coli and Salmonella. A 2023 study found 40% of manual depilation tools tested positive for pathogens (NCBI).

Technical Specifications
| Goat Hair Removal Machine - Model YC-GHR-2026 | |
|---|---|
| Capacity | 200-300 goats/hour (adjustable) |
| Hair Removal Rate | ≥99.8% |
| Power Supply | 380V/50Hz (Customizable to 220V/60Hz) |
| Power Consumption | 3.5 kW |
| Dimensions (LxWxH) | 2200 x 1200 x 1800 mm |
| Weight | 850 kg |
| Material | 304/316L Stainless Steel |
| Roller Speed | 0-1400 RPM (Variable Frequency Control) |
| Noise Level | <75 dB |
| Safety Features | Emergency Stop, Overload Protection, IP67 Electrical Components |
| Certifications | CE, ISO 9001, HACCP, FDA (Pending) |
| Warranty | 2 Years (Parts), 1 Year (Labor) |

5. What’s the maintenance requirement?
Daily: Rinse with water and inspect rollers (5 minutes).
Weekly: Lubricate bearings (automatic system) and check belts.
Monthly: Deep clean with food-grade disinfectant.
Annual: Professional inspection (included in warranty).
